Starfieid, in response to your quote: "The serpent in the garden, Satan, was once a cherub and shone like copper......? I don't know. Tough question! hahaha"

Rev. 12:9, the serpent is Satan, who fell from the sky (Luke 10:18) as one of the angels, agreed on by 2Pt. 2:4. He was thus an angel, not a cherub. Cherubs do not lead angels (study Ezek. 1)

The key is to look the words up in Stongs concordance: Copper, from bronze, 5153 is nachosh, nun-chet- vav-shin. Serpent 5175, nachash, nun-chet-shin. In Hebrew, the vowels (vav) are optional, so they are the same word, near-homonymns.

The reason I brought it up was not only for a nice question, but to stress how much we miss reading English: Num. 21:9, Moses makes a serpent of brass, nachash of nachosh, and sins, because Num. 21:8 directs him to make a serpent - seraph (a different thing) and the serpent is later worshiped by the Israelites as an idol 2Ki. 18:4. In English we miss the whole story about Moses' sin.

Actually we don't know how many "wise men" there were Matt 2 v 1 just says wise men from the East but not how many. V 11 says they brought 3 gifts so it has led to people thinking there must have been 3 men. But all we know is that there were at least 2 men, there could have been several wise men. I have heard people speak on the birth of Jesus saying that because the gifts were very expensive it is quiet plausible there could have been a whole crowd of wise men but we don't know for sure. The Bible also does not name them.
